3D human body model is an indispensable element in films and computer games. It also has many applications in medical equipment, clothing design, image processing, etc. Human body model that is obtained through scanning cannot be used directly. As the scene may change, moderating the size of the current model is the priority of model manipulation. Meanwhile, the operation difficulty of model manipulation, the practicability of deformation and its effect also require consideration. With these questions in mind, we’ve learned and referenced a lot of deformation methods and brought in semantics driving model deformation method on the basis of the existing models and methods. By measuring the bone joint point position of the model, we’ve got semantics values like height, length of legs and height of shoulders in order to adjust the related semantics value of model, finally got the new model after adjustment.The main purpose of this thesis is to obtain the semantics parameters by measuring the model and further drive model deformation by adjusting these parameters.The first thing to do is obtaining semantics of model. The first step is to measure height, length of legs and height of shoulders of model by extracting the coordinates of joint point. Then calculate waist and bust circumference of the joint point of the model in order to get fitting function of waist, bust circumference and weight on the basis of MPI laboratory model library. By verifying the error of fitting functions within the scope of permit, we import model library of Princeton university in the system to calculate the corresponding semantics values.The second step is to adjust semantics values and to drive model deformation. Use PCA dimension reduction to obtain the model parameter values needed for the deformation of model then map the model to PCA space. Modify semantics values of model to drive model deformation.On the basis of this procedure, we designed a software platform for studying3D human model driven by semantics to experiment. By comparing the experiment results, it turns out to be a better deformation result through model deformation driven by semantics.
